Obituary of Arline E. Taylor
Arline E. (Noelle) Taylor, 96, of Newburgh passed away on Saturday, August 6, 2022. She was born June 11, 1926 in Posey County, Indiana to the late Carl F. and Selma A. (Hausman) Noelle. Arline was employed with Credit Bureau of Evansville and was a longtime member of Bethel United Church of Christ. She was also a member of the Hadi Motor Bells, Deaconess Hospital Auxiliary and Daughters of the Nile. She served on the board of directors of the Evansville Vanderburgh County Libraries, the board of the Indiana State Public Library Association of Indianapolis and the PTA while her children were in school. Her hobby was painting for years with the Rivertown Chapter of Decorative Artists. She dearly loved her son and grandchildren and was very proud of their accomplishments. She was married to the love of her life James L. Taylor for 66 ½ years until his death in 2014. She was also preceded in death by sisters and brothers-in-law, Ellen Phillips (Deward) and Joyce Probstein (Irwin) and brother and sister-in-law, Albert Noelle (Louise). Arline is survived by her beloved son, Ritchie L. Taylor; grandchildren, Devin N. Taylor and Caitlyn N. Taylor; great grandchildren, Charles and James Taylor, and longtime friends, Bob and Carolyn Bennett.
